THE INTERFACIAL IMPEDANCE VARIATION OF V6O13 COMPOSITE ELECTRODES DURING LITHIUM INSERTION AND EXTRACTION

Composite V6O13 electrodes were characterized in cells having metallic lithium counter and reference electrodes. The overall impedance changes closely follow the variation of the V6O13 unit cell volume. An abrupt change in unit cell volume if reflected in a corresponding abrupt change in the interfacial impedance. The variation of the interface impedance implies that the integrity of the electrode structure changes during the lithium insertion and extraction processes.
